About A38 Trerulefoot

A38 Trerulefoot is a major A38 junction east of Liskeard. The area is served by the A38 and A374, connecting it to Saltash and St Germans. Local landmarks include Trerulefoot roundabout and Trerule Stores. Trerulefoot roundabout where the A38 meets the A374 to Looe is one of east Cornwall's busiest junctions — regular breakdown territory. Equipment We Carry

Our 7.5 ton recovery truck carries a heavy-duty hydraulic winch rated to 8 tonnes, steel wire rope for extreme loads, oversized securing chains and straps, and an extended deck for longer vehicles. The truck features rear-facing cameras for safe loading operations.
